Set along the River Derwent and surrounded by limestone cliffs, it’s a popular spot for strolls along the riverside promenade, fish and chips, arcades, and ice cream.
Visitors can explore the Heights of Abraham via cable car, enjoy dramatic views, and discover historic caverns. With its quirky charm and relaxed atmosphere, Matlock Bath offers a perfect day out or short break for families, couples, and nature lovers alike.

Matlock Aquarium
Matlock Bath Aquarium & Exhibitions, located in a historic Victorian building in
Matlock Bath, offers a unique and educational experience for visitors. The aquarium houses over 50 species of fish, including a renowned collection of Mirror, Common, and Koi Carp in its thermal pool, which is fed by a natural spring believed to be 2,000 feet underground.
Other attractions include one of Europe’s largest public hologram displays, the only remaining petrifying well in Matlock Bath, a gemstone and fossil exhibit, and a nostalgic ‘Past Times in Matlock Bath’ exhibition

Peak Village Shopping Centre
Peak Village, located in Rowsley near Matlock, is a charming shopping destination nestled in the heart of the Peak District. This outlet shopping centre offers a mix of well-known brands and local independent shops, providing a unique retail experience. Visitors can explore a variety of stores, including Denby Pottery, Regatta, and The Derbyshire Makers, offering everything from sustainably made tableware to outdoor adventure gear and handmade crafts. The centre also features Peak Adventure, an indoor play area for children, and hosts regular events such as pop-up markets and family fun days.
